服务器测评网
我们一直在努力

本地服务器监控如何实现实时状态监控?

本地服务器监控是保障企业IT基础设施稳定运行的核心环节,通过对本地服务器状态的实时、全面监控,能够及时发现潜在问题、快速定位故障根源,从而确保业务连续性和系统性能优化,在数字化转型加速的今天,企业对本地服务器的依赖度依然较高,尤其是在数据安全、合规性要求较高的场景下,本地服务器监控的重要性愈发凸显。

本地服务器监控如何实现实时状态监控?

本地服务器监控的核心价值

本地服务器监控的核心价值在于“防患于未然”,与云端服务器相比,本地服务器通常承载着企业核心业务数据与关键应用,一旦出现故障,可能导致业务中断、数据丢失等严重后果,通过部署完善的监控系统,管理员可以实时掌握服务器的CPU、内存、磁盘、网络等硬件资源使用情况,以及操作系统、数据库、中间件等软件的运行状态,当CPU使用率持续超过阈值时,系统可自动触发告警,提醒管理员排查是否存在异常进程或资源瓶颈,避免服务器因过载而宕机,监控数据还能为容量规划、性能优化提供数据支撑,帮助企业合理分配IT资源,降低运维成本。

本地服务器监控的关键指标

有效的本地服务器监控需覆盖多维度指标,以下为核心监控项及其意义:

硬件资源监控

  • CPU监控:包括CPU使用率、负载均衡(1分钟、5分钟、15分钟平均负载)、上下文切换次数、中断数等,高CPU使用率或异常负载可能表明计算资源不足或存在恶意程序。
  • 内存监控:关注内存使用率、可用内存、交换分区(Swap)使用情况,内存不足会导致系统响应缓慢,甚至触发OOM(Out of Memory) killer机制,终止关键进程。
  • 磁盘监控:监控磁盘使用率、IOPS(每秒读写次数)、读写延迟、磁盘错误率等,磁盘空间耗尽或I/O瓶颈可能引发服务异常,例如数据库写入失败。
  • 网络监控:跟踪网络带宽利用率、丢包率、延迟、连接数等,网络异常会影响业务访问速度,甚至导致通信中断。

系统与进程监控

  • 操作系统状态:监控系统运行时间、登录用户数、系统日志(如Kernel、Systemd日志)中的错误信息,确保操作系统内核及关键服务正常运行。
  • 进程监控:关注关键进程(如Web服务、数据库进程)的存活状态、CPU/内存占用情况,Nginx进程异常退出会导致网站无法访问,需立即告警并重启。

服务与应用监控

  • 端口监控:检查关键端口(如80、443、3306)是否正常监听,判断服务是否对外可用。
  • 应用性能监控:针对业务应用监控响应时间、吞吐量、错误率等指标,例如电商系统的订单接口响应时间过长可能影响用户体验。

日志监控

日志是故障排查的重要依据,通过集中收集和分析服务器日志(如Access Log、Error Log、安全日志),可快速定位问题根源,通过分析SSH登录日志,可发现异常登录尝试,及时防范安全风险。

本地服务器监控的实施架构

一套完整的本地服务器监控系统通常由数据采集、数据处理、数据存储与可视化展示四部分组成:

数据采集层

通过代理(Agent)或无代理方式采集监控数据,常用工具包括:

本地服务器监控如何实现实时状态监控?

  • Zabbix:支持多种Agent(如Zabbix Agent、SNMP),可监控服务器、网络设备等多种对象。
  • Prometheus + Exporter:通过Exporter采集各指标数据,Prometheus负责抓取和存储,适合云原生环境。
  • Nagios:经典的开源监控工具,通过插件扩展监控能力,适合中小规模环境。

数据处理层

对采集到的原始数据进行清洗、聚合和告警判断,设置CPU使用率连续5分钟超过80%为告警阈值,避免误报。

数据存储层

时序数据库(如InfluxDB、TimescaleDB)常用于存储监控数据,因其高效读写和压缩特性,适合处理高频时间序列数据。

可视化展示层

通过仪表盘(Dashboard)直观展示监控数据,常用工具包括Grafana、Kibana等,Grafana可对接Prometheus、Zabbix等数据源,自定义图表,实现服务器状态的一屏览。

告警机制与故障响应

告警是监控系统的“神经中枢”,需遵循“精准、及时、可操作”原则:

  • 分级告警:根据故障严重程度划分告警级别(如紧急、重要、一般),通过邮件、短信、企业微信等多渠道通知相关人员。
  • 告警收敛:避免同一问题触发大量重复告警,可设置告警抑制规则,例如同一服务器集群故障只发送一条集群级告警。
  • 故障响应流程:明确告警接收、处理、升级的闭环流程,例如紧急告警需在15分钟内响应,30分钟内解决或升级。

本地监控与云监控的协同

随着混合IT架构的普及,本地服务器监控需与云监控平台对接,实现统一管理,通过云平台的API获取本地服务器的性能数据,在云Dashboard中与云服务器状态对比分析,便于跨环境资源调度与故障排查。

本地服务器监控如何实现实时状态监控?

监控数据的安全与合规

监控数据包含服务器配置、业务访问记录等敏感信息,需加强安全防护:

  • 数据加密:传输过程中采用TLS加密,存储时加密敏感字段。
  • 访问控制:基于角色(RBAC)限制监控数据的访问权限,仅授权人员可查看。
  • 合规性:遵循《网络安全法》《数据安全法》等法规,确保监控数据留存与使用符合要求。

未来趋势:智能化与自动化

随着AI技术的发展,本地服务器监控正向智能化演进:

  • 异常检测:通过机器学习算法分析历史监控数据,自动识别异常模式(如周期性性能波动),提前预警。
  • 自动化运维:结合监控数据触发自动化脚本,例如磁盘空间不足时自动清理临时文件,CPU过载时自动重启关键服务,减少人工干预。

本地服务器监控是企业IT运维的“眼睛”和“耳朵”,通过构建覆盖硬件、系统、应用、日志的全维度监控体系,结合智能告警与自动化运维,可有效提升服务器稳定性,为业务发展保驾护航,随着监控技术与AI、云原生技术的深度融合,本地服务器监控将更加智能、高效,助力企业实现数字化转型的目标。

赞(0)
未经允许不得转载:好主机测评网 » 本地服务器监控如何实现实时状态监控?